JuliaWeb HTTP.jl up to 1.10.16 crlf injection

A vulnerability described as problematic has been identified in JuliaWeb HTTP.jl up to 1.10.16. The impacted element is an unknown function. Such manipulation leads to crlf injection. This vulnerability is uniquely identified as CVE-2025-52479. The attack can be launched remotely. No exploit exists. Upgrading the affected component is recommended.

A vulnerability was found in JuliaWeb HTTP.jl up to 1.10.16. It has been rated as problematic. Affected by this issue is an unknown code block. The manipulation with an unknown input leads to a crlf injection vulnerability. Using CWE to declare the problem leads to CWE-93. The product uses CRLF (carriage return line feeds) as a special element, e.g. to separate lines or records, but it does not neutralize or incorrectly neutralizes CRLF sequences from inputs. Impacted is integrity. CVE summarizes:

HTTP.jl provides HTTP client and server functionality for Julia, and URIs.jl parses and works with Uniform Resource Identifiers (URIs). URIs.jl prior to version 1.6.0 and HTTP.jl prior to version 1.10.17 allows the construction of URIs containing CR/LF characters. If user input was not otherwise escaped or protected, this can lead to a CRLF injection attack. Users of HTTP.jl should upgrade immediately to HTTP.jl v1.10.17, and users of URIs.jl should upgrade immediately to URIs.jl v1.6.0. The check for valid URIs is now in the URI.jl package, and the latest version of HTTP.jl incorporates that fix. As a workaround, manually validate any URIs before passing them on to functions in this package.

The advisory is shared for download at github.com. This vulnerability is handled as CVE-2025-52479 since 06/17/2025. The exploitation is known to be easy. The attack may be launched remotely. No form of authentication is required for exploitation. There are neither technical details nor an exploit publicly available.

Upgrading to version 1.10.17 eliminates this vulnerability. Applying a patch is able to eliminate this problem. The bugfix is ready for download at github.com. The best possible mitigation is suggested to be upgrading to the latest version.
